How to install on a Path of Titans community server

Three steps. Stop the server first - mod changes only apply on startup.

  1. 1

    Find the Mod ID

    In Path of Titans, open the Mods page, select the mod, and copy the Mod ID (it looks like UGC_M_...).

    For this mod: UGC_M_6GW0YZY73Z_SK (use the Copy button on the right).

  2. 2

    Edit your server files

    1. Log in to your server panel and STOP the server.
    2. Navigate to the config directory, usually: /PathOfTitans/Saved/Config/LinuxServer
    3. Open GameUserSettings.ini and find or create the header:
    [PathOfTitans.Mods]
    EnabledMods=UGC_M_6GW0YZY73Z_SK
    #Divine Beasts: Deinosuchus

    Add a new EnabledMods=ModID line for each mod you want enabled. The # line is an optional comment - useful for keeping the file readable when you have many mods.

    Save the file and restart your server. The mod downloads on startup.

  3. 3

    Setting up a custom map (if applicable)

    If the mod is a custom map, you also need to set the map name in Game.ini:

    1. Get the map file name from the mod author or the mod files (look for a .umap).
    2. Open Game.ini and add under the [/Script/PathOfTitans.IGameSession] header:
    [/Script/PathOfTitans.IGameSession]
    ServerMap=MapFileName

    Save the file and start your server.
